git分支创建软件

fiy 其他 31

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Git分支是一个非常有用的功能,可以让我们在开发软件时更加高效和灵活。下面是关于如何使用Git创建分支的步骤和方法。

    步骤1:进入项目目录
    首先,打开终端或命令行界面,并切换到你的项目目录。例如,通过`cd`命令进入项目目录:`cd /path/to/your/project`

    步骤2:创建分支
    使用`git branch`命令创建一个新的分支。例如,创建一个名为`feature`的新分支:`git branch feature`

    步骤3:切换分支
    继续使用`git checkout`命令来切换到新创建的分支。例如,切换到`feature`分支:`git checkout feature`

    步骤4:进行开发
    现在你已经切换到`feature`分支,可以在该分支上进行你的开发工作。你可以修改代码、添加新功能或解决问题,而不会影响到主分支或其他分支的开发进度。

    步骤5:提交更改
    完成所需的更改后,使用`git add`命令将更改的文件添加到暂存区,然后使用`git commit`命令提交更改。

    步骤6:合并分支
    一旦你在`feature`分支上完成了开发工作并且通过了测试,你可以将该分支合并到主分支或其他需要的分支上。使用`git merge`命令进行分支合并。例如,将`feature`分支合并到主分支:`git merge feature`

    步骤7:解决冲突(如果有)
    在合并分支时,可能会出现冲突。这是因为在两个分支上同时进行了修改,在合并时需要手动解决冲突。你可以使用`git status`命令查看冲突文件,然后手动编辑这些文件来解决冲突。

    步骤8:删除分支
    在分支合并后,如果不再需要这个分支,可以使用`git branch -d`命令删除分支。例如,删除`feature`分支:`git branch -d feature`

    通过以上步骤,你就可以轻松地创建和管理Git分支,实现更加高效和灵活的软件开发。Git分支使得团队合作更加容易,同时也可以保持主分支的稳定性,提高开发效率。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    创建分支是git工具中非常重要的功能之一,它可以让开发人员在不影响主分支的稳定性的情况下,在不同的分支上进行并行开发、实验和问题修复。下面是有关git分支创建的一些指南和建议:

    1. 创建分支的命令:要创建一个新的分支,可以使用git branch命令,后跟一个分支的名字。例如,要创建一个名为”featureA”的新分支,可以使用以下命令:git branch featureA。请注意,这只是在本地创建了一个分支,但不会将分支上传到远程仓库。要将分支推送到远程仓库,需要使用git push origin featureA,将”featureA”分支推送到名为”origin”的远程仓库。

    2. 切换分支的命令:要切换到创建的分支,可以使用git checkout命令。例如,要切换到名为”featureA”的分支,可以使用以下命令:git checkout featureA。切换分支后,所有的代码更改将在该分支上进行,并且可以独立于其他分支进行开发。

    3. 合并分支的命令:当在分支上进行开发完成后,可以将其合并回主分支或其他分支。使用git merge命令可以实现分支合并。例如,要将”featureA”分支合并回主分支,可以使用以下命令:git checkout main(切换到主分支),git merge featureA(将”featureA”分支合并到主分支)。

    4. 解决分支冲突:在合并分支时,可能会出现冲突,这是由于两个分支上对同一行代码的更改冲突所致。当发生冲突时,git会提示你手动解决冲突。可以使用git diff命令查看冲突的代码,并手动编辑以解决冲突。解决完冲突后,使用git add命令将解决的文件添加到暂存区,然后使用git commit命令提交更改。

    5. 删除分支的命令:当不再需要一个分支时,可以使用git branch -d命令来删除它。例如,要删除名为”featureA”的分支,可以使用以下命令:git branch -d featureA。请注意,删除分支只会删除本地分支,要删除远程仓库中的分支,需要使用git push origin –delete featureA命令。

    通过使用git工具创建和管理分支,开发人员可以更好地组织和跟踪代码的不同版本,从而加快开发速度,并确保代码的稳定性和可维护性。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    一、什么是Git分支?

    Git是一个分布式版本控制系统,它允许团队协作开发,并且能够跟踪和管理不同版本的代码。在Git中,分支是指从主线上分离出来的一个新的代码线,它可以在不影响主线代码的情况下进行独立的开发工作。

    二、为什么要使用Git分支?

    使用Git分支有以下几个好处:

    1. 独立开发:每个分支都可以独立地进行代码开发和提交。

    2. 版本控制:分支的创建和合并能够方便地进行代码版本的管理。

    3. 并行开发:不同的团队成员可以在不同的分支上进行并行开发工作。

    4. 故障隔离:当在某个分支上出现故障时,不会影响到其他分支的代码。

    三、如何创建Git分支?

    在Git中,分支的创建非常简单,可以通过以下几个步骤来完成:

    1. 查看当前分支:首先,可以使用以下命令查看当前所在的分支:

    “`
    git branch
    “`

    该命令会列出所有已经创建的分支,并用一个星号(*)标记当前所在的分支。

    2. 创建分支:如果要创建一个新的分支,可以使用以下命令:

    “`
    git branch
    “`

    这里的``是你要创建的分支的名称。

    3. 切换分支:创建了分支之后,可以使用以下命令切换到该分支:

    “`
    git checkout
    “`

    这样就可以切换到指定的分支,开始在该分支上进行开发工作。

    4. 提交代码:在切换到新的分支之后,可以进行代码的开发和修改,然后使用以下命令将修改的代码提交到该分支:

    “`
    git add .
    git commit -m “commit message”
    “`

    这样就可以将修改的代码提交到当前分支。

    四、如何合并分支?

    在开发过程中,可能需要将不同分支的代码合并到一起,可以使用以下几个步骤来完成:

    1. 切换到目标分支:首先,可以使用以下命令切换到想要合并到的目标分支:

    “`
    git checkout
    “`

    这里的``是你想要合并到的目标分支的名称。

    2. 合并分支:切换到目标分支之后,可以使用以下命令将其他分支的代码合并到当前分支:

    “`
    git merge“`

    这里的``是你想要合并的分支的名称。

    注意:在合并过程中可能会产生冲突,需要手动解决冲突后再进行提交。

    3. 提交代码:当合并完成并解决了冲突之后,可以使用以下命令将合并的代码提交到目标分支:

    “`
    git add .
    git commit -m “merge branch”
    “`

    这样就可以将合并的代码提交到目标分支上。

    五、分支管理的最佳实践

    使用Git分支进行代码管理时,可以采用以下几个最佳实践:

    1. 使用有意义的分支名称:分支名称应该能够反映分支上所进行的代码开发工作。

    2. 频繁提交代码:在进行代码开发的过程中,应该经常性地提交代码,避免在出现问题时丢失大量的开发工作。

    3. 合并前进行代码审查:在进行分支合并之前,应该进行代码审查,确保合并的代码是正确的。

    4. 删除不需要的分支:在分支合并后,不再需要的分支应该被及时删除,以保持代码仓库的整洁。

    总结:

    通过以上步骤,可以简单地创建和管理Git分支,实现团队协作开发和版本控制。使用Git分支可以提高开发效率和代码管理的灵活性。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部